当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储文件系统,对象存储与文件系统的协同进化,从架构解构到云原生融合的技术实践

对象存储文件系统,对象存储与文件系统的协同进化,从架构解构到云原生融合的技术实践

对象存储与文件系统协同进化是云时代存储架构创新的核心方向,传统对象存储与文件系统长期存在架构壁垒,新型混合架构通过解构存储层级,将对象存储的分布式特性与文件系统的强一致...

对象存储与文件系统协同进化是云时代存储架构创新的核心方向,传统对象存储与文件系统长期存在架构壁垒,新型混合架构通过解构存储层级,将对象存储的分布式特性与文件系统的强一致性机制深度融合,技术实践中,采用分层架构设计实现元数据管理、数据存储与计算分离,通过标准化API接口实现多协议互通,同时引入容器化部署、微服务化治理和动态扩展能力,构建云原生存储中台,典型案例显示,该架构在混合云环境支持PB级数据动态调度,存储利用率提升40%,时延降低至50ms以内,未来演进将聚焦智能化数据治理、边缘计算协同及跨云元数据互通,推动存储架构向全栈云原生持续迭代。

(全文约2478字)

引言:存储世界的范式革命 在数字化转型浪潮中,全球数据量正以年均26%的增速爆发式增长(IDC,2023),传统文件系统与对象存储的边界正在消融,这场存储架构的进化不仅关乎技术迭代,更折射出数据管理范式的根本转变,本文通过解构两者的技术基因,揭示其协同演进的技术路径,为构建新一代智能存储系统提供理论支撑。

对象存储的技术解构 2.1 核心架构特征 对象存储采用"数据即服务"(Data-as-a-Service)的核心理念,其架构包含四个关键组件:

  • 分布式元数据服务器:采用一致性哈希算法实现键值存储,支持10^6级QPS查询
  • 数据分片引擎:通过K/V对齐算法将对象拆分为128MB-256MB的独立分片
  • 分布式存储集群:基于纠删码(Reed-Solomon)的3+2或5+3冗余机制
  • 网络传输层:支持HTTP/3的QUIC协议,实现零连接开销的传输优化

2 数据管理范式 对象存储突破传统文件系统的目录层级限制,采用资源标识符(RI)体系:

对象存储文件系统,对象存储与文件系统的协同进化,从架构解构到云原生融合的技术实践

图片来源于网络,如有侵权联系删除

  • 唯一性标识:采用UUIDv7生成全局唯一对象ID
  • 版本控制:通过时间戳戳分实现版本溯源
  • 密钥管理:集成AWS KMS、Azure Key Vault等硬件安全模块
  • 权限体系:基于ABAC(属性基访问控制)的动态策略引擎

3 性能指标突破 在阿里云oss实测数据中,其TPS可达28万(5分钟窗口),随机读延迟<50ms(99% percentile),支持单集群PB级数据在线扩容,对比传统NFS的1万级QPS,性能提升达200倍。

文件系统的演进轨迹 3.1 传统架构瓶颈 POSIX文件系统面临三大桎梏:

  • 逻辑结构僵化:目录层级深度限制(Windows支持256层)
  • 扩展性局限:单文件4GB ceiling(NTFS)与32TB ceiling(ext4)
  • 并发控制复杂:锁机制导致CPU争用率超35%(Linux trace数据)

2 分布式文件系统革新 以Ceph为例的技术突破:

  • 智能对象存储层:CRUSH算法实现无中心化数据分布
  • 实时同步引擎:CRUSH-MDS支持千万级文件实时更新
  • 跨存储池优化:统一命名空间下的异构存储混合部署
  • 智能负载均衡:基于文件热度的自适应迁移策略

3 新型文件系统架构 新一代文件系统呈现三大特征:

  • 微服务化架构:元数据服务、数据服务、缓存服务解耦
  • 智能分层:热数据SSD缓存+温数据HDD池+冷数据归档库
  • 动态容错:基于QoS的自动故障隔离与数据重组

技术融合的实践路径 4.1 架构融合方案 对象存储与文件系统的协同架构包含三个关键模块:

  • 智能路由层:采用DHT分布式哈希表实现混合访问
  • 数据统一元数据:基于图数据库Neo4j的关联映射
  • QoS保障引擎:四维调度算法(读/写/带宽/延迟)

2 典型应用场景

  • 大数据湖仓融合:对象存储(Delta Lake)+文件系统(Hudi)的混合架构
  • 实时分析场景:Kafka+Hudi+Spark的端到端流水线
  • 智能运维体系:Prometheus+Grafana的存储健康监测

3 性能调优实践 在腾讯云TDSQL系统中,通过以下技术组合实现性能突破:

  • 对象存储冷热分离:热数据对象存储(S3-compatible)+冷数据归档存储
  • 智能预取算法:基于LRU-K的混合访问模式预测
  • 异构设备调度:SSD缓存池(10TB)+HDD存储池(50TB)
  • 容错优化策略:基于Paxos的元数据快速恢复(<200ms)

云原生时代的融合趋势 5.1 微软Azure的Hybrid Storage方案 采用"对象存储+文件系统"双引擎架构:

对象存储文件系统,对象存储与文件系统的协同进化,从架构解构到云原生融合的技术实践

图片来源于网络,如有侵权联系删除

  • 存储池抽象层:统一管理500+异构存储设备
  • 智能分层策略:基于AI的访问模式预测
  • 跨云同步:Azure Data Box Edge实现边缘缓存

2 华为OceanStor的智能存储系统 其FusionStorage 3.0版本实现:

  • 存储即服务化:通过SDS架构实现对象/文件存储即服务
  • 智能压缩引擎:基于神经网络的动态压缩算法(压缩比达1:15)
  • 自动分层存储:根据访问频率自动迁移数据(延迟优化62%)

3 开源生态演进 Ceph社区最新版本(16.2.0)的技术突破:

  • 对象存储层:支持S3v4和Swift协议的统一接入
  • 文件系统层:集成XFS和ZFS的混合存储模式
  • 智能运维:基于Prometheus的预测性维护(故障率降低78%)

技术挑战与未来展望 6.1 现存技术瓶颈

  • 跨协议转换开销:对象/文件协议转换导致15-30%性能损耗
  • 安全认证集成:多租户环境下的细粒度权限管理复杂度
  • 持续集成挑战:混合架构的CI/CD流程构建复杂度(平均需3周)

2 未来演进方向

  • 存储语义化:基于JSON Schema的存储对象结构化
  • 能效优化:存储设备功耗管理(PUE<1.1)
  • 智能运维:基于知识图谱的故障诊断(准确率>95%)
  • 存储即计算:对象存储原生支持计算加速(FPGA卸载)

构建智能存储新范式 在对象存储与文件系统的协同进化中,技术融合已从概念验证走向工程实践,通过架构创新、智能调度和生态整合,新一代存储系统正在突破传统性能边界,为AI大模型训练、数字孪生等新兴场景提供弹性支撑,随着存储即服务(STaaS)的成熟,企业数据管理将进入"存储即资源"的新纪元,这既是技术发展的必然趋势,也是数字化转型的关键基础设施。

(注:本文数据均来自公开技术白皮书及实验室实测报告,技术细节已做脱敏处理)

黑狐家游戏

发表评论

最新文章